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: 1)Patients with Mild to moderate acne vulgaris 2)Patients willing to participate in the study
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: 1)Pregnant and lactating mothers 2)Patients allergic to Lactosporin and Adapalene 3)Patients who used topical corticosteroids ,antibiotics or retinoids within the past two weeks on the face 4)Patients who used systemic corticosteroids, antibiotics or retinoids within the past 1 month
Design outcomes
Primary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| Compare the clinical response with the help of Global acne grading system and comparing the therapeutic efficacy of Adapalene 0.1% Gel versus Lactosporin 2% Gel in the treatment of mild to moderate Acne VulgarisTimepoint: Every week during the course of treatment, at the end of 4 weeks of treatment | — |
Secondary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| Treatment side effects, RecurrenceTimepoint: For a period of 4 weeks after cessation of treatment | — |
